After current draft boss Will McClay took over the reigns of running the draft process in 2013, Ciskowski descended the ranks and settled into more of an advisory capacity without supervisory responsibilities. A native of Loreauville, La., Vital graduated from Nicholls State and as a running back, was selected in the seventh round (185th overall) of the 1985 NFL Draft by the Washington Redskins. Ciskowski had his share of successes but some of his final years as draft chief were notorious for big misses, most notably the special teams draft of 2009 where the Cowboys selected twelve players, most of whom failed to make any substantial impact.
